Man Arrested on Province Wide Warrant.
The Antigonish County Street Crime Enforcement Unit has arrested Jeremy Nickerson, who was wanted on a province-wide warrant.
Nickerson, 46, of Pictou County, was wanted for multiple offences, including weapons offences, assault, threats, and failure to comply with court conditions. After the arrest, which took place on October 18, he is now facing an addition charge of Resist Arrest.
“This arrest took place after significant investigation by our teams, but it would not have been possible without support from the public,” says S/Sgt. Kim Hillier, Antigonish RCMP Detachment Commander. “The tips and information provided by the Antigonish community were an important factor in the safe arrest.”
Nickerson appeared at Antigonish Provincial Court on October 23 and remains in custody pending future court appearances.
